There are a couple of reasons. Firstly, the Gators had experience. Secondly, Corey Brewer shut down Ron Lewis. Much is made about Conley and Oden, but Lewis was averaging 20something a game til the final. Brewer's underpublicized defense held Lewis in check just as it shut down Arron Afflalo of UCLA(for the second time in the Final Four). Lastly, Ohio State had shown a tendency to let inferior teams stay in games with them and to allow opponents to get sizable leads on them in the tournament before they would inevitably rally to win, as in the Tennessee and Xavier games. Eventually, Ohio State ran into a Florida team that was too good to fall behind on, period. Florida beat Ohio State because they wanted it more and knew that you have to play hard and play well for 40 minutes to win a championship. Ohio State won many games playing mediocre for periods of time and then playing a great last 10 minutes, fifteen minutes etcetera. Florida deserves a lot of credit for their remarkable feat of repeating as champs.
